Australian Kelpie category: Australian Kelpie is admitted in the Federation Cynologique Internationale registry. The breed is included in the section «Sheepdogs» (1.1) in the category «Sheepdogs and Cattle Dogs». Federation Cynologique Internationale label for australian kelpie is 293 and was added to the registry 1989-09-11. United Kennel Club recognizes the breed as «Herding Dogs» in their registry. Canadian Kennel Club categorizes the breed as «Herders».
